Provides physical therapy treatment in accordance with the plan of care established by the physicaltherapist. Recommends changes in treatment plan to the supervising physicaltherapist based upon the patient's condition and response to treatment. Maintains work area in a neat, orderly fashion. Directs therapy volunteers. Performs clerical responsibilities as required by the facility. Transports patients as necessary in a safe, comfortable, courteous, timely and professional manner via prescribed transport vehicles.

The certified occupational therapy assistant provides occupational therapy services under the direction of the OT. The certified occupational therapy assistant performs only those services planned, delegated, and supervised by the registered occupational therapist and according to the physician plan of care.
Essential Job Functions/Responsibilities
* Participates in the ongoing evaluation of patient's functional status (muscle function, endurance, visual coordination, written and verbal communication skills, self care ability, work capacity, etc.) as delegated by the registered occupational therapist. Participates in the ongoing evaluation of the home environment for hazards or barriers to more independent living as delegated by the registered occupational therapist.
* Participates in teaching new skills or retraining patients in once familiar daily activities that have been lost due to illness or injury, in accordance with organization policy.
* Maintains appropriate clinical records, clinical notes, and reports to the registered occupational therapist any changes in the patient's condition.
* Submits clinical documentation in accordance with Organization policy.
* Follows treatment program and goals for improved patient function as established by the registered occupational therapist. Documents patient's response to treatment plan and progress toward established goals.
* Maintains contact/communication with other personnel involved in the patient's care to promote coordinated, efficient care. Documents such communication in accordance with Organization policy.
* Attends and contributes to in-services, case conferences, and other meetings as required by Organization policy to ensure coordinated and comprehensive plans of care for the patients of the Organization.
* Identifies patient and family/caregiver needs for other home care services. Consults with the supervising registered occupational therapist and assists with necessary referrals, as appropriate.
* Participates in instructing patient's family/caregiver and other Organization health care personnel in patient's treatment regime as delegated by the registered occupational therapist.
* Is supervised by the registered occupational therapist no less than every thirty days. Documentation in the clinical record will reflect ongoing communication between the registered occupational therapist and certified occupational therapy assistant, the patient's condition, the patient's response to services provided by the assistant, any need to change the plan of care, and patient outcomes.

Job Title: PhysicalTherapistAssistant Summary: Assistsphysicaltherapists in providing physical therapy treatments and procedures. May, in accordance with state laws, assist the development of treatment plans, carry out routine functions, document the progress of treatment, and modify specific treatments in accordance with patient status and within the scope of treatment plans established by a physicaltherapist by performing the following duties.
Duties and Responsibilities:. Other duties may be assigned.
* Instructs, motivates, safeguards, and assists patients as they practice exercises and functional activities.
* Confers with physical therapy staff or others to discuss and evaluate patient information for planning, modifying, and coordinating
* Administers active and passive manual therapeutic exercises, therapeutic massage, and heat, light, sound, water, anodyne, and electrical modality treatments, such as ultrasound, electrical stimulation, lontophoresis, assistive devices, body mechanics, paraffin, and joint
* Observes patients during treatments to compile and evaluate data on patients' responses and progress, to report to physical
* Measures patients' range-of-joint motion, body parts, and vital signs to determine effects of treatment for the patient's evaluations and then re-evaluates to include overall re assessment and manual muscle testing.
* Secures patients into or onto therapy equipment.
* Fits patients for orthopedic braces, prostheses, and supportive devices such as
* Trains patients in the use of orthopedic braces, prostheses, and supportive
* Transports patients to and from treatment areas, lifting and transferring them according to positioning requirements.
* Monitors operation of equipment and records use of equipment and administration of
* Cleans work area and checks, cleans, and stores equipment after
* Assists patients to dress, undress, or put on and remove supportive devices, such as braces, splints, and slings.
* Administers traction to relieve neck and back pain, using intermittent and static traction

How much does a physical therapist assistant earn in Millcreek, PA?
The average physical therapist assistant in Millcreek, PA earns between $36,000 and $64,000 annually. This compares to the national average physical therapist assistant range of $40,000 to $70,000.
Average physical therapist assistant salary in Millcreek, PA
$48,000
